Jamaica is one of my favorite places to visit. I have been to Jamaica four times now, once to Montego Bay and three times to Negril. In 2010, I took my kids and we went to Beaches in Negril. We were supposed to go to Beaches Boscobel, but found out at the last moment that our booking was going to be transferred to Beaches Negril, and it turned out to be a great vacation. It was absolutely fantastic – an all-inclusive vacation that can just about parallel any all-inclusive cruise (and you know I love cruises)! What was nice about this vacation was that the Beaches Negril property overlooks the beach, and some of the water activities such as the Banana Boat are included. One night there was a beach party where dinner was served out on the beach, on tables that had white table-cloths spread out on them. It looked really fancy outside, and the buffet was scrumptious, there were even fresh coconuts – everyone lined up for them and were drinking the refreshing juice of the coconuts right out of the shell.
